Sidra Medicine Achieves ISO:27001 Certification

News

08 February 2023, Doha, QatarSidra Medicine, (a member of Qatar Foundation), has achieved the benchmark ISO:27001 Information Security Management System (ISMS) certification for its entire information technology function and operations.

ISO:27001 is an internationally recognized standard to manage information security and the main reference to set out the requirements for an information security management system. The standard outlines the rules for implementing, operating and continuously improving the systems. Sidra Medicine’s ISO certificate was issued by TUV Rheinland, a German certifying body. It is one of the top testing and certifying organizations worldwide, in the areas of security, safety, and quality.

The ISO:27001 certification applies to the information security standards across the broad spectrum of IT services at Sidra Medicine, such as network and security infrastructure; operations; IT systems; end-user computing; analytics; enterprise and clinical applications; as well as imaging services.  The implementation is aimed at protecting the healthcare organization from business risks such as data leaks, hacking or regulation breaches.
